TOKYO, April 17 (Reuters) - Japanese drugstore operator Welcia Holdings said on Wednesday President Tadahisa Matsumoto has stepped down due to "inappropriate behaviour in his private life".

Matsumoto, 64, had been an officer of the company for 16 years, according to LSEG data. (Reporting by Kantaro Komiya and Rocky Swift; Editing by Muralikumar Anantharaman)
